Cream Cheese and Pecan Stuffed Strawberries
Ingredients
- 20 whole large strawberries with tops cut off
- 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
- ¼ cup powdered sugar
- ¼ teaspoon vanilla or almond extract
- 2/3 cup Chopped pecans
Preparation
- Cut a thin slice from the bottom of each strawberry so the berries stand upright.
- Place berries, cut side down, on a serving latter.
- Carefully cut the berries into 4 wedges, cutting almost to, but not through, the bottoms with a criss-cross cut.
- Fan wedges just slightly, taking care not to break them.
- Set aside.
- In a mixing bowl, beat together the c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la until combined but still stiff.
- Using a teaspoon or pastry bag with a decorative tip, fill the strawberries with the cream cheese mixture.
- Sprinkle chopped pecans on top and refrigerate until ready to serve.
